No, the 2003 Murano does not have a telescopic steering wheel.
Before you plunk down money on the car I suggest you crawl underneath and take a look at the front drivetrain. Specifically, look for signs of oil leakage where the front half-shafts connect to the transmission. If they are dry then all is fine. If the connections are wet with oil then I would walk away.

Hey great year for the MO!!!!!
I was also look into as just an FYI if the alternator was reaplced as there was a recall. If not get it done but good news is that it will be covered by our friends at Nissan. There are also some other recalls to specifically the fuel shield and the rear seat belts (now with the extra "package" coming I would think you would be interested. :p
